From The Apostolic Report
The ALJC (Assemblies of the Lord Jesus Christ) has embarked on a process to create a new multi-faceted advertising campaign.
The first facet of the campaign was the writing, shooting and editing of four national quality 30-second television commercials. All four of the commercials conclude with a place that can be customized by individual ALJC churches contact information. (Spots can be viewed by visiting www.aljc.org/commercials).
The videos were produced by Andy Dean, an award winning videographer and producer who has worked for ABC, ESPN, and NBC as well as several well known recording artists.
The second facet of the campaign is a website, http://hopeforyou.org/ that corresponds with the commercials. The people who view the commercials are directed to this site. Here, viewers can find more information about the “hope” that is available to them, testimonies and links to the churches who are and decide to participate in the advertising campaign.
